The writ-petitioner has filed a writ of mandamus for directing the respondents to supply the copy of order dated 10.04.2015 vide which recounting of votes has been ordered by the Presiding Officer, Election Tribunal, District Moga.

After having heard learned counsel for the petitioner, we do not find that petitioner can be permitted by this Court to claim a writ of mandamus to supply a copy of the order. Firstly, it is only a period 12 days after the orders were passed out of which there were many vacations. Still further, the petitioner can make grievance before the appellate authority if the copy was not supplied to him. But this Court cannot act as an agency to supply copy of the order to the aggrieved parties.

Dismissed.
